The Office of Information Technology (OIT) is Rutgers’ enterprise IT office. OIT provides university wide services and support and collaborates with department and unit IT professionals on projects and initiatives for the Rutgers community. OIT’s services and systems include the Rutgers network; email and calendaring systems; IDs/passwords and identity management; data centers; computer labs; help desk support; wireless connectivity; a software portal; information security, risk, and compliance services; research computing; and many others. Posting Summary Rutgers, The State University of New Jersey, is seeking an Application Developer III for the Office of Information Technology. This position reports to the Director IT of OIT/EARC Student Information System (SIS).

Among the key duties of this position are the following: Serves as a key developer and team lead for all aspects of software development lifecycle including tools, methodology and best practices for the SIS Transformation project and accountable for the implementation and support of the next generation of the Rutgers enterprise student information system and services on Oracle Fusion Cloud ecosystem. Stays current on emerging technologies and leading approaches in Higher Education, leading and driving project discussions and technical workshops and interacting with third-party vendors. Plans, coordinates and executes spans across multiple disciplines to develop robust, holistic solutions for project assignments. Performs a wide variety of tasks, including recommending and architecting new technology solutions, defining configuration and extension standards along with technical approaches for conversions, interfaces, and reports. This position is also a key contributor to the ongoing EARC’s evolution and development of cloud computing strategies, roadmaps, and plans. Provides high-level analysis, guides other members, and groups within the department and oversees the implementations designed and developed by other team members.
